AI in urban planning and administration at Ringkøbing-Skjern Municipality

We are currently working with Ringkøbing-Skjern Municipality to explore how artificial intelligence, including AI image generation tools and no-code chatbots, can enhance various everyday work processes such as administration, illustration, and urban planning. We have conducted two hands-on workshops as part of this collaboration. Our ultimate goal is to help the municipality implement AI tools to improve their work processes, better meeting the needs of citizens and stakeholders. Through this project, we have established a partnership for an international EUR Horizon grant application about inclusive sustainable planning, realizing our ambitions for sustainable development.

AI image generator tools: Shaping the future 

In our collaboration with Ringkøbing-Skjern Municipality, we aim to "shape the future" by making it easier for everyone to visualize and engage with upcoming changes. By using AI image generator tools like ChatGPT, stable diffusion, and crea.visions, we directly influence how urban landscapes are envisioned. These tools provide vibrant visualizations that effectively communicate future possibilities to stakeholders, moving beyond traditional text to create compelling visual narratives.

This approach not only simplifies stakeholder involvement but also improves our interaction and collaboration efficiency with them. Importantly, it ensures that community input is central to shaping our urban spaces, fostering a more collaborative planning process. This enhances creativity and efficiency, reducing the need for deep technical expertise. Through this effort, we aim to make urban planning more accessible to everyone in Ringkøbing-Skjern Municipality. 

In the workshop, we utilized AI image generator tools to envision a potential future for a communal Christmas decoration in Ringkøbing town square and to illustrate the outcome if all surrounding shops embraced the concept. Edited using Playground.AI.


No-code chatbot: Streamlining tasks and communication 

During the workshop, we also developed a chatbot. Constructed using official documents and tailored with data specific to Ringkøbing-Skjern Municipality, this chatbot enhances municipal operations and administrative tasks.
